Digital TV increases to 41% of Dutch households
Oct 3, 2007 – In the Netherlands, the digitalisation of media and communication services continues at a fast pace. Digital TV now reaches 41% of all households, an increase of 50% compared with last year.

DIRECTV, EchoStar May See Declining Subscriber Growth in Next Five Years, Pike & Fischer Study Predicts
Oct 2, 2007 – Satellite TV providers DIRECTV and EchoStar have been building customer loyalty with services such as high-definition channels and upgraded digital video recorders. But they are likely to see their customer growth fall significantly over the next five years, a new report from Pike & Fischer suggests.

Triple-play Uptake Growing At the Expense of Telco Margins, says Pyramid Research
Oct 2, 2007 – Global triple-play subscriptions are projected to grow by a whopping 52% in 2007, to over 34m, according to Pyramid Research's latest report, "From Triple-play to Quad-play: Strategies, Business Models, and Best Practices."

Gartner Says Saturation of U.S. Pay-TV Market to Create Challenges for Emerging IPTV Services
Oct 1, 2007 – As Internet Protocol television (IPTV) services emerge, telecom companies face a fairly saturated pay-TV market in the U.S, as 82 percent of all U.S. households reported having a pay-TV subscription in 2006, according to a recent survey by Gartner, Inc.

Convergence Driving European TV Progress
Oct 1, 2007 – New research published today by Informa Telecoms & Media shows that digital TV penetration of Western European households will break the 50% mark by the end of this year.

Almost one-third of Dutch TV connections are digital
Oct 1, 2007 – The total number of Dutch TV connections stabilised at 7.027 million connections at the end of the second quarter of 2007, with the number of digital TV connections growing by 4.2 percent to 2.2 million, according to Telecompaper's quarterly update on the Dutch TV market.
